City of Brookfyn Center 2013 CAPITAL IMPROVEMENT PROGRAM PROFILE The 2013-27 Capital Improvement Plan (CIP) is a planning document that presents a fifteen-year overview of scheduled capital projects to address the City's goals for maintaining public infrastructure. The CIP includes a long-term financing plan that allows the City to allocate funds for these projects based on assigned priorities. The fifteen-year horizon of the CIP provides the City with an opportunity to evaluate project priorities annually and to adjust the timing, scope and cost of projects as new information becomes available. The information contained in this plan represents an estimate of improvement costs based on present knowledge and expected conditions. Changes in community priorities, infrastructure condition and inflation rates require that adjustments be made on a routine basis. A capital improvement is defined as a major non-recurring expenditure related to the City's physical facilities and grounds. The 2013-2027 CIP makes a concerted effort to distinguish between major maintenance projects contained in the City's operating budgets and capital improvement projects financed through the City's capital funds and proprietary funds. Typical expenditures include the cost to construct roads, utilities, parks, or municipal structures. The CIP is predicated on the goals and policies established by the City Council, including the general development, redevelopment, and maintenance policies that are part of the City's Comprehensive Plan. A primary objective of the CIP is to identify projects that further these goals and policies in a manner consistent with funding opportunities and in coordination with other improvement projects. CIP Project Types The Capital Improvement Plan proposes capital expenditures totaling just under $121 million over the next 15 years for basic improvements to the City's streets, parks, public utilities, and municipal buildings. A brief description of the four functional areas is provided below. Public Utilities The City operates four utility systems, all of which have projects included in the CIP water, sanitary sewer, storm drainage, and street lighting. A vast majority of the public utility improvements are constructed in conjunction with street reconstruction projects. The remaining portion of public utilities projects include improvements to water supply wells,water towers, lift stations, force mains and storm water treatment system. Street Improvements Street improvements include reconstruction or resurfacing of neighborhood (local), collector and arterial streets. Proposed improvements include the installation or reconstruction of curb and gutter along public roadways. As noted earlier, street improvements are often accompanied by replacement of public utilities. Park Improvements Park improvements include the construction of trails, shelters, playground equipment, athletic field lighting and other facilities that enhance general park appearance and increase park usage by providing recreational facilities that meet community needs. 323 Capital Maintenance Building Improvements Capital maintenance building improvements include short and long term building and facility improvements identified in the 18-year Capital Maintenance Building Program approved in 2007. CIP Funding Sources Capital expenditures by funding source for the fifteen-year period are shown in Table 1 and Figure 1. Major funding sources are described below. Public Utility Funds Customers are billed for services provided by the City's water, sanitary sewer, storm sewer, and street lighting public utilities. Fees charged to customers are based on operating requirements and capital needs to ensure that equipment and facilities are replaced to maintain basic utility services. Annually the City Council evaluates the needs of each public utility system and establishes rates for each system to meet those needs. Capital Improvements Fund This fund is comprised of transfers from the General Fund, repayment of debt from the Golf Course operating fund, and transfers from liquor operations. Typically the City Council has directed these funds towards municipal facilities such as parks,trails,public buildings and other general purpose needs. Special Assessment Collections Properties benefiting from street and storm sewer improvements are assessed a portion of the project costs in accordance with the City's Special Assessment Policy. Every year the City Council establishes special assessment rates for projects occurring the following year. Rates are typically adjusted annually to maintain the relative proportion of special assessments to other funding sources. Street Reconstruction Fund The Street Reconstruction Fund provides for the cost of local street improvements along roadways that are not designated as municipal state aid routes. The revenue for this fund is generated from franchise fees charged for the use of public right-of-way by natural gas and electric utility companies. The City's ability to provide adequate revenue for the Street Reconstruction Fund is currently one of the main limiting factors in determining the rate at which future street and utility improvements can be accomplished. Municipal State Aid(MSA)Fund State-shared gas taxes provide funding for street improvements and related costs for those roadways identified as MSA streets. The City has 21 miles of roadway identified as MSA streets and is therefore eligible to receive funding based on this designation. The annual amount available is approximately $830,000 and provides for maintenance and construction activities within the City's MSA street system. Funds to be Determined A dedicated funding source for portions of the Capital Maintenance Building Improvements is yet to be determined. The Liquor Store Enterprise fund was used in 2008 and 2009. In 2010, accumulated unspent funds in the General fund in excess of the amounts required by cash flow needs were used. Street Lighting The current cost estimate includes replacing the 3 wood poles with 3 fiberglass poles with a decorative rectilinear fixture and underground power. 366 Miscellaneous Water Main and Sanitary Sewer Improvements Lift Station 1 Wet Well Improvements The existing lift station was installed in 1996. The current wet well design is a basic rectangle with an elevated wing wall. The flat bottom allows for solids to build and the wing wall traps grease thereby creating an ongoing maintenance issue where staff is required to enter the space multiple times per year for maintenance. To properly clean this wet well, workers must follow confined space entry procedures and enter the 28' deep structure. Even when all necessary precautions are followed, there is a significant level of danger involved when entering the structure. The goal is to "reshape" the wet well by mimicking the existing wet well at lift station 2 and eliminate the elevated wing wall. The wet well at lift 2 consists of a sloped configuration that nearly eliminates the buildup of any solids (rarely is it necessary to enter that wet well).Proposed rehabilitation includes pump replacement, miscellaneous appurtenance replacement, and wet well reconfiguration to aid in self-cleaning. Water Tower No.3 Painting Tower No. 3, a 1.5 million gallon elevated storage tank located within the Centerbrook Golf Course was constructed in 1973. The complete exterior coating system was replaced in 1986. In 1998 the exterior was spot repaired, power washed and a urethane top coat was applied to the exterior of the tower. In 2005, the bottom shell course of the fluted exterior was coated and the entire exterior was power washed. This tank was last inspected in 2010. Although the steel substrate is still protected, a number of coating failures were noted on the interior (wet area and dry area) and are attributed to deficiencies in the coating system itself. The 2010 recommendation is to reevaluate in 5 years with an anticipated plan of complete coating replacement in 6 to 8 years. Based on the 2010 evaluation, Tower No. 3 is recommended for complete interior wet, interior dry and exterior coating rehabilitation in 2016. Water Tower No.2 Painting Water Tower No. 2, a one-million gallon elevated storage tank located at 69"' Avenue and Dupont Avenue was constructed in 1960. In 1984, the interior (wet area) and exterior coating systems were completely replaced. In 1997, the interior coating system (wet area) was spot repaired and the exterior coating was spot repaired, power washed and a urethane top coat was applied to the existing system. The estimated service life for 1997 paint coating is 15 to 20 years as noted in a 1999 warranty inspection report. This tank was last inspected in 2005. Both the interior and exterior coatings required no repairs at that time. The 2005 recommendation is to re- inspect every 5 years. Tower No. 2 is scheduled to be inspected in 2011. Based on a 2009 review of the 2005 recommendation, Tower No. 2 is recommended for complete interior and exterior coating rehabilitation in 2017. The following buildings and facilities are covered under this plan: city hall, community center, public works facility, public works cold storage building, public works salt/sand storage building, police station, west fire station, east fire station, Centerbrook Golf Course club house, Centerbrook Golf Course maintenance building, Centerbrook Golf Course storage garage, sanitary lift station Nos. 1 and 2, municipal well Nos 2-10, Evergreen Park building, Garden City Park building, Central Park west building, Central Park plaza, and Central Park gazebo. 368 Storm Water Improvements Connections Shingle Creek Restoration Project As part of the 2009 Connections at Shingle Creek Corridor Study, a section of Shingle Creek from Regent Avenue in Brooklyn Park to Nobel Avenue was assessed for opportunities to provide ecological restoration. Additionally, Shingle Creek has been identified as having dissolved oxygen and biotic impairments that must be addressed. The first phase of this project includes the restoration of the portion of the creek from Brooklyn Boulevard to 700-feet east of Noble Avenue. Restoration improvements include repairing eroded stream bank areas, adding riffles and plunge pools, thinning out the significant tree canopy, installing culvert energy dissipating rip rap and slope protection and establishing a wider vegetated wetland/upland buffer adjacent to the creek. The City of Brooklyn Center will be responsible for only a portion of the project funding. The proposed funding is expected to include 50% City funding (25% from Brooklyn Center and 25% from Brooklyn Park), 25% grant funding and the remaining 25% to be shared by the Shingle Creek Watershed Management Commission. This project is anticipated to proceed only upon successful grant award. Storm Water Management Basins In 2005, the City of Brooklyn Center hired the consulting firm of Bonestroo Rosene Anderlik & Associates to conduct a condition assessment of 30 storm water management ponds located throughout the City. The assessment process resulted in a list of improvements to address problems with shoreline erosion, sediment accumulation, inlet and outlet blockages and other miscellaneous maintenance issues. Below is a description of the projects that were not considered routine annual maintenance work normally addressed as part of the annual operating budget for the Storm Drainage Utility. Storm Water Pond 60-001 Pond 60-001 is located west of Xerxes Avenue and south of Brooklyn Drive within Central Park. The pond receives runoff from approximately 85 acres of upstream residential development. This pond was constructed in 2003. By 2013, preliminary estimates indicate that approximately 30 to 40 percent of the wet volume will be lost due to sediment accumulation. The proposed work consists of removal of sediment and installation of a skimmer structure to enhance the water quality treatment performance of the pond. Storm Water Pond 50-001 Pond 50-001 is located within Cahlander Park. The pond receives runoff from approximately 230 acres of upstream residential development. Due to the large watershed to pond area ratio, this pond is subject to higher rates of sediment accumulation and potential erosion issues. Traces of hydrocarbon pollutants were noted in the sediment during the most recent site inspection. The proposed project consists of dredging and properly disposing of sediment from the pond and repairs to various shoreline erosion issues. Storm Water Pond 46-001 Pond 46-001 is located within the northern portion of Orchard Lane Park. The pond receives runoff from approximately 60 acres of residential development located west of Orchard Lane Park and approximately 50 acres located north of Interstate 94/694. The pond is was originally design as a detention basin without wet volume to provide additional water quality benefit. The proposed improvements consist of excavating wet storage volume below the invert of the outlet pipe to increase the water quality treatment performance of the basin. 369 Park and Trail Improvements Baseball Backstop Replacements Proposed construction includes replacement of the baseball backstop fences at Centennial Park, Freeway Park and Willow Lane Park. Centennial Park Softball Field Re-grading Improvements The Centennial Park softball fields experience settlement due to the underlying organic soils. Over the years, settlement has occurred approximately one foot. This is evident in the fact that the light base foundations within the ball field areas have generally held their original elevations and are higher than the surrounding ground. Due to the proximity to Shingle Creek and the low lying areas, this settlement causes increased flooding and drainage issues. The proposed plan includes raising the ball fields one to two feet and replacement of any necessary appurtenances including irrigation systems, draintile, fences and bituminous/concrete trails and other paved areas.
